What do we mean by bubbleheads?

A stupid person.

A submariner; bubble-head.

A navy hard hat or salvage diver (inspired by the shape of the old spun-copper diving helmet).

Navy slang for a sailor stationed aboard a submarine. Opposite of a skimmer. Urban Dictionary

A secluded street in unincorporated north St. Louis county, official name is Carrico Road. Urban legend states something to the effect that years ago, people settled near the end of the road. Through years of inbreeding, the descendants of the original settlers developed hydrocephaly, or "Water on the Brain," which caused their heads to be oversized, hence the term "bubblehead." This is a relatively famous urban legend in NoCo St. Louis, with many residents convinced of some truth behind it. Indeed, when you drive to the end of the road there and several "No Tresspassing" signs. I mean, A LOT of signs. I've heard of many people getting chased off at night by unseen figures in the woods.
